INSS deposits on Thursday last batch of review by the ceiling to 29 thousand insured

The INSS closes, on Thursday, calling the payment review by the ceiling, with the deposit of the last batch of money to 29,594 policyholders. They have the right to receive amounts over R$ 19,000. In all, R$ 850 million transferred to the beneficiaries.

Retirees can know whether they will receive the review www.inss.gov.br accessing the e-mail address and clicking the link "Consultation to review the ceiling," in the "Agency electronics: insured." Then you must enter the number of the benefit, the CPF, date of birth and full name. You can also obtain information by calling 135, the call center Social Security.
Understand the case

The revision of the ceiling was granted a total of 107,000 policyholders who have contributed to the high values INSS because they wanted to receive the pension ceiling. However, they did not have their benefits adjusted in 1998 and 2003, when there were two security reforms, which raised the maximum benefit to R$ 1,200 and R$ 2,400, respectively.

When these ceilings were established, many pensions of between 5 April 1991 and January 1, 2004, whose letters granting reported that the initial monthly rent was "limited by the ceiling" were reduced.
The Federal Supreme Court (STF) ruled in favor of cause to retirees, giving them the right to review.
